Thika climate
Thika is warmest in February, with average highs of 27 °C, and coldest in July, when nights average 13 °C. April is the wettest month (188 mm) and September the driest (23 mm). Figures are 1991–2020 climate normals.
Across a full year Thika averages 963 mm of rain and 119 days above 25 °C.

What to expectThika through the year
Thika has a clear annual cycle: average daily highs run from 22 °C in July to 27 °C in February, a swing of 3.1 °C in mean temperature across the year.
Counted across a normal year, 119 days a year reach 25 °C, 1 of them reach 30 °C. The warmest reading in the 1991–2020 record is 33 °C, in March.
Rain is strongly seasonal. April averages 188 mm against 23 mm in September — 8.1 times as much. Planning around the dry months matters more here than planning around temperature.

Temperature month by month
| Month | Avg high | Avg low | Mean | Record high | Record low | Days above 25 °C | Days above 30 °C | Days below 0 °C |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| January | 25.1 °C | 14.2 °C | 19.4 °C | 29.8 °C | 10.4 °C | 16 | 0 | 0 |
| February | 26.8 °C | 14.7 °C | 20.4 °C | 31.2 °C | 11.5 °C | 24 | 0 | 0 |
| March | 26.5 °C | 15.4 °C | 20.4 °C | 32.9 °C | 11.7 °C | 24 | 1 | 0 |
| April | 24.5 °C | 15.9 °C | 19.3 °C | 29.7 °C | 12.4 °C | 9 | 0 | 0 |
| May | 23.4 °C | 15.1 °C | 18.7 °C | 26.8 °C | 10.8 °C | 2 | 0 | 0 |
| June | 22.4 °C | 13.9 °C | 17.9 °C | 26.9 °C | 10.5 °C | 1 | 0 | 0 |
| July | 21.9 °C | 12.9 °C | 17.2 °C | 27.3 °C | 8.9 °C | 2 | 0 | 0 |
| August | 22.5 °C | 13.2 °C | 17.6 °C | 26.9 °C | 9.4 °C | 3 | 0 | 0 |
| September | 24.7 °C | 13.7 °C | 18.9 °C | 29.6 °C | 10.3 °C | 15 | 0 | 0 |
| October | 25.1 °C | 14.9 °C | 19.4 °C | 30.5 °C | 11.8 °C | 16 | 0 | 0 |
| November | 23.1 °C | 15.0 °C | 18.3 °C | 27.2 °C | 11.7 °C | 2 | 0 | 0 |
| December | 23.6 °C | 14.4 °C | 18.5 °C | 27.3 °C | 11.4 °C | 4 | 0 | 0 |
Rain, sun and wind month by month
| Month | Rainfall | Wet days | Daylight | Cloud cover | Humidity | Wind |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| January | 43 mm | 8 | 12 h/day | 52 % | 70 % | 14 km/h |
| February | 38 mm | 6 | 12 h/day | 51 % | 63 % | 15 km/h |
| March | 80 mm | 14 | 12 h/day | 60 % | 68 % | 14 km/h |
| April | 188 mm | 25 | 12 h/day | 77 % | 81 % | 11 km/h |
| May | 137 mm | 20 | 12 h/day | 74 % | 80 % | 9.8 km/h |
| June | 50 mm | 10 | 12 h/day | 79 % | 76 % | 9.1 km/h |
| July | 26 mm | 7 | 12 h/day | 81 % | 73 % | 9.2 km/h |
| August | 33 mm | 9 | 12 h/day | 79 % | 70 % | 9.7 km/h |
| September | 23 mm | 6 | 12 h/day | 66 % | 65 % | 11 km/h |
| October | 98 mm | 15 | 12 h/day | 72 % | 69 % | 12 km/h |
| November | 173 mm | 24 | 12 h/day | 78 % | 83 % | 12 km/h |
| December | 75 mm | 16 | 12 h/day | 60 % | 79 % | 13 km/h |

QuestionsCommon questions about Thika’s climate
When is the best time to visit Thika?
That depends on what you want, so the honest answer is a comparison rather than a single month. February, March, October sit closest to 20 °C on average, February is the warmest month and September the driest. The month-by-month table above has the full picture.
How hot does Thika get?
In February, the warmest month, daily highs average 27 °C. About 1 days a year pass 30 °C. The highest value in the 1991–2020 record is 33 °C.
How cold does it get in winter?
Nights average 13 °C in July, the coldest month. Freezing nights are not part of a normal year here.
Which month is wettest in Thika?
April, averaging 188 mm over 25 days with rain. The driest month is September with 23 mm. The year as a whole averages 963 mm.
Are these figures a forecast?
No. They are 1991–2020 climate normals: the average of thirty years, which describes what a month is usually like in Thika rather than what any particular week will bring. Individual years can differ substantially from the normal.
